#0cbc55 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#0cbc55 is composed of 4.7% red, 73.7%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 54.8%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 144.9 degrees, a saturation of 88% and a lightness of 39.2%. #0cbc55 color hex could be obtained by blending #18ffaa with #007900. Closest websafe color is: #00cc66.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000402 is the darkest color, while #f0fef6 is the lightest one.
